how much commission does a realtor make in nj: Real-estate agents are commonly paid through compensation agreed in listing or buyer-representation contracts and settled at closing, but the amount and who pays are negotiable and market-specific. Read the signed agreement and closing disclosure rather than assuming a universal percentage.
